ALDIs in Australia require that you put a $2 coin into the trolley lock to release it. You get the money back when you return the trolley.

If you can't be bothered to walk back with the trolley, you'll find there's always a young volunteer who will gladly earn himself $2 for the trouble.

ALDIs were also the first to stop issuing plastic bags; you bring your own or carry it loose to the car!
